Science may fail horror movie fans because a new study claims to have found the scariest movie of all time, and it’s not « The Exorcist » or « Nosferatu » In fact, it is the movie « Sinister » which is not so popular among horror fans
“The Science of Scare Project” is a study by Broadbandchoicescom, which claims to be “the experts on mobile, TV and the internet” on its journey to find the scariest horror movie , 50 people spent over 120 hours watching 50 of the best horror movies of all time, according to critics’ reviews Throughout the experiment, the heart rates of the participants were monitored
After completing all of the movies, contestants had the highest heart rates after watching Sinister hit 86 BPM, which is nowhere near the 65 average.The movie showed how Ethan Hawke and his family experienced the experience when they moved into a house where a long haired demon called « Bughul » would lead to a series of murders In 2012, the film received only mixed reviews, which may surprise most horror fans
While watchers ‘heart rates peaked at 131 BPM while watching « Sinister, » it was 2010 supernatural film Insidious, which had the best fear of jumps as participants’ heart rates soared at 133 BPM at one point Insidious is another mediocre movie that received mixed reviews from critics, ranked second as average heart rate hit 85 BPM

While the study is interesting and includes some really scary movies on this list, the methodology used is questionable as it does not seem to reflect the true meaning of what a « scary movie » is. There is indeed more only loud noises, scares and heartbeats in a horror movie
A Huffpost article listed eight ways horror movies use to scare audiences Check out the list below:
Horror movies create lasting images, which stick with the audience even after they return home Sometimes the scenes are really intense and people still remember them even for days, years and even everything throughout their life
Scary images must be shocking, strange, disturbing, or sometimes even out of place because humans remember something they cannot understand
Most of the time the public is afraid of what they don’t see They are afraid of what they have created from their imagination However, with the popularity of CG technology, these scary killers or monsters are quite disappointing, which breaks the idea of the unknown Thus, the level of intensity and fear is reduced
Anticipation is perhaps the most used element of horror film When the hero is terrified as he crawls on the ground, viewers expect something frightening to happen

Anticipation gives them an adrenaline rush, which makes horror a very popular genre Anticipation is the key to a successful horror movie Fear must be built into the process
Location is what makes a horror movie when it becomes a character in the movie A Scary Place surely makes the movie creepy
Phobias are psychological disorders that involve a strong, persistent or irrational fear from a specific situation or thing It allows a person to avoid the thing they are afraid of
Phobias directly affect the public Touching a more common phobia means a larger audience that will be instantly frightened without much effort
The thought of being chased by a psycho-killer or a monster instantly sends audiences into an adrenaline rush, as it triggers their instinct for survival as well as their curiosity about what it feels like to be continued
A deranged killer, ghost, demon, alien or other creatures are all monsters, which can make or break a horror movie Of course, it depends on the story and how effective the monster created
